
Anna Lois Doss Mead, daughter of Dwight William and Mary Imogene Pipes Doss was born on Friday, November 13, 1925 in Pasadena, CA. She was the middle child of five. Ann peacefully left us, to be with the Lord, on Saturday, June 1, 2013 at the age of 87. She will be greatly missed.
Early in life Anna changed her name to Ann. Ann graduated from Roosevelt High School (1943), received her BA (1950) and MA (1963) in Education at California State University, Fresno. She worked 33 years for Fresno Unified School District and was an adjunct faculty member of Ottawa University. Ann touched the lives of many people throughout her varied work career.
Ann married Jack Whitby in 1946 and their daughter, Jan Tracy Whitby, was born on June 25,1957. Ann was divorced from in 1959 and married Charles Reed in 1966. She and Mr. Reed were divorced in 1977.
In 1988 she joined a group of bicyclists and rode across country for the American Lung Association. On that trip she met Larry Mead. Their friendship blossomed after the trip and in 1990 she married the love of her life. During the next 17 years, she and Larry enjoyed traveling the world, much of it on bicycles.
In 2007 she lost her beloved Larry to cancer. Soon after Larry's death, Ann decided to ride 82 miles on her 82nd birthday with her long-time friends. It was a tradition that she had begun with Larry, riding their age in miles every birthday. At 82 years-young she had endured breast cancer, two hip replacement surgeries, logged thousands of miles on her bicycle and still completed the 82 miles. She was a survivor.
Ann was blessed with numerous talents. She loved to play the piano and organ at Fresno First Baptist Church. She was also a vocalist, a motivational speaker, and program specialist. She was blessed with a talent in writing. She published several books of poetry and children's stories. She loved to present musical and lecture type programs for specific audiences. Because her talents were a gift to her, Ann was dedicated to sharing them with others in her church and in her community.
She was a strong and faithful member of Fresno First Baptist Church and of several educational organizations.
She was preceded in death by her husband Lawrence "Larry" Mead; her sisters, Betty January, Julia Steffensen, and Mary Jean Steffensen.
She is survived by her loving daughter, Jan Tracy Whitby Reed, brother, Dwight William Doss, Jr. and his wife, Shelley of Dallas, Texas, stepdaughter Melody Lucas, stepson Randy Mead and his wife Patti, stepson David Mead and his wife Barbie, grandchildren Matthew, Anthony, April, Kevin and Tyler, and numerous nieces and nephews.
